What if the pain and difficulties that arise in relationships are not something to run away from but, rather, are the keys to true intimacy and more personal freedom?
What if the situations that arise when the honeymoon is over, offer the secret doorway to freedom, joy, and bliss?
That secret doorway is what the authors of ‘Falling in Love Backwards, an Unlikely Tale of Happily Ever After’ discovered in their journey on the path of relationship together.
They’d been on parallel paths in many ways, both traveling the world, looking for answers to the deep questions in life and for a true partner. They were each committed to freedom and to living awake, and had gone as far as they could go on their own.
The rest of the healing would need to take place in the depths of an intimate relationship.
Their relationship didn’t start out with a fantasy love bubble; in fact, he wasn’t that interested in her because she "didn’t fit his pictures" of who his partner should be.
But as they stood in the center of a real and alive connection, they took on the challenges that were there from the beginning, head on.
In the process, they discovered a Happily Ever Afterbetter than they dreamed was possible.
By sharing their story, they hope that you can too.

Diane Covington-Carter graduated with honors from UCLA and has received awards for her writing, photography, and NPR commentaries. She has been a life coach for more than thirty years, on a quest to discover the truth about the mysteries of happiness and love, both for herself and others.
For more than forty years, Landon Carter has dedicated his life to learning about and understanding how we create reality and to sharing those insights. A graduate of Andover, Yale University, and Harvard Business School, he has been a trainer with est (now Landmark Education) and several other human potential and business organizations.
Landon and Diane lead seminars and work with individuals and couples internationally. They live in Northern California and New Zealand.
